Massachusetts FY2010 Budget Approved
Sales & Use Tax to Increase
In April Feeley & Driscoll reported that a majority in the Massachusetts House of Representatives and the Senate approved a proposed FY2010 budget. On June 29, 2009 Governor Patrick signed a $27.046 billion budget for next year cutting aid to cities and towns, reducing support for agendas throughout state government, and inflicting a sales tax hike and additional taxes on the residents, consumers, and visitors of Massachusetts. The sales and use tax will increase from 5% to 6.25% -- the increase goes into effect on August 1, 2009.
